Karim Mostafa Benzema is one of the best strikers in European football and rated by Zinedine Zidane as the greatest in French football history.
The 33-year-old began his career at local side Bron Terraillon before moving to the Lyon youth academy in 1997. He made his senior debut in January 2005 and featured sporadically across the next few seasons.
2007/08 campaign was Benzema’s breakthrough campaign. It was the moment he truly announced himself to Europe, with an impressive 31 goals in 52 appearances in all competitions – including four in only seven Champions League games.
Not only did the striker’s exploits help Lyon win a seven consecutive Ligue 1 title, but they won him the league’s Golden Boot and Player of the Year awards.
A €35m transfer to Real Madrid followed in the summer of 2009 for Benzema, who has since won every competition imaginable in Spain.
He has shone alongside the likes of Cristiano Ronaldo to help Los Blancos embark on a historic era that won them 18 major honors, including four Champions League, four FIFA Club World Cups, and three La Liga titles.
Benzema is also the club’s fourth-highest goalscorer in history on 259 goals in 529 appearances and earned 81 caps for the French national team until 2015.
